Brand new #evokehq
Evoke Creative is investing in a new head office on the back
of growing international demand for its interactive digital
products and continuing expansion of its team.
The multi-award winning company, which designs
and manufactures interactive products for leading retail,
leisure, hospitality businesses, including JD Sports Fashion,
Google, McDonald’s and Tesco will move to a new base on
the Wirral, Merseyside, in late 2017.
Evoke Creative, which exports its products to more
than 60 countries worldwide and has delivered dramatic
revenue growth over the last four years of 42%, has signed
a deal with Redsun Developments to take two units at its
£5.5m Power Station development at Wirral International
Business Park, Bromborough, close to its current location
on the business park.
In preparation for the move, the company has
conducted a number of sessions with staff using virtual
reality technology to gain their input. Its design team
is working closely with the building contractor and
architect to deliver a collaborative and creative working
environment, incorporating state of the art warehousing
and factory facilities, which are some four times the size of
the present head office.
